SPOILERS: Heart of Stone (2001) is a serial killer/thriller film. There is a ritualistic murder of a co-ed during the opening credits, then we see Angie Everhart preparing a birthday party for her daughter, who is about to start college. After the party, Everhart tries to seduce her own husband, who is frequently away on business. At this point in the film, about 5 minutes in, based on the man's character and the way they introduced him, I figured he must be the killer. |

"The Fatigues," the sixth episode of Seinfeld ’s eighth season (1996), centers on Frank Costanza overcoming a 1950s cooking disaster to cater a Jewish Singles event, while Elaine deals with a terrifying, military-clad mailroom employee. The episode, which won a Writers Guild of America award, features a memorable parody of Platoon where Frank relives his war trauma during a kitchen crisis. For more details, visit WikiSein .
